1. **State the problem:** We need to find the volume of a cylinder with height $h = 82$ ft and diameter $d = 77$ ft.
2. **Formula for the volume of a cylinder:**
$$V = \pi r^2 h$$
where $r$ is the radius and $h$ is the height.
3. **Find the radius:**
The radius is half the diameter:
$$r = \frac{d}{2} = \frac{77}{2} = 38.5 \text{ ft}$$
4. **Calculate the volume:**
$$V = \pi (38.5)^2 (82)$$
5. **Intermediate calculation:**
$$V = \pi \times 1482.25 \times 82$$
6. **Multiply:**
$$V = \pi \times 121509.5$$
7. **Use $\pi \approx 3.1416$:**
$$V \approx 3.1416 \times 121509.5 = 381,785.15$$
8. **Final answer rounded to nearest hundredth:**
$$\boxed{381785.15 \text{ cubic feet}}$$
